Overview
The University of Texas–Pan American intends to use its Hispanic-Serving Institutions Assisting Communities (HSIAC) grant to take information, resources, and training out to residents of the relatively isolated Delta Region communities through the use of the university’s proposed Mobile Community-Development Initiative (MCDI). The mobile unit is a 38-foot air-conditioned fifth-wheel trailer, equipped with seating and laptop computers and Internet access for up to 15 persons. Staffed by a trainer and community development specialists, the unit will be towed by truck to low-income neighborhoods in the Delta Region to provide resources, information, and training to low-income residents on a variety of community needs as identified by residents in the Delta Region Revitalization Corporation's Comprehensive Strategic Plan for Economic Development and other planning documents and surveys. Through MCDI, residents will gain convenient access to information, resources, and training that will stabilize and contribute to sustainable development of the Delta Region communities.
